The painting Lemminkäinen's Mother by Finnish artist Akseli Gallen-Kallela is an impressive work depicting the epic story of Finnish mythology. The painting, measuring 86 x 109 cm, was created in 1897 and is one of the artist's most famous works.

Gallen-Kallela's artistic style is unique and distinctive. He was known for his nationalistic style, which was inspired by nature and Finnish culture. In Lemminkäinen's Mother, her artistic style can be clearly seen, combining realistic and symbolic elements to create a powerful and evocative image.

The story behind the painting is fascinating. Lemminkäinen's mother is an important character in Finnish mythology. In the story, her son Lemminkäinen is killed and she resurrects him with the help of a magical bird. Gallen-Kallela's painting depicts this moment of resurrection and shows the strength and power of Lemminkäinen's mother.
